Mulch fabric installation involves laying down a durable, woven material over garden beds, flower borders, or landscaped areas to create a protective barrier. This fabric helps prevent weeds from growing through mulch, reducing the need for manual weeding and chemical herbicides. The installation process typically includes preparing the soil surface, cutting the fabric to fit the designated area, and securing it in place before adding mulch on top. This service is ideal for homeowners seeking a low-maintenance way to keep their gardens tidy and healthy.

One of the primary problems mulch fabric addresses is weed intrusion. Unwanted plants can quickly take over garden beds, competing with desirable plants for nutrients and water. By installing a weed barrier, property owners can significantly reduce weed growth, saving time and effort on upkeep. Additionally, mulch fabric helps with moisture retention, keeping soil consistently moist and protecting plant roots during hot or dry periods. It also prevents soil erosion on slopes or uneven terrain, making it a practical solution for various landscaping challenges.

What is mulch fabric installation? Mulch fabric installation involves placing a permeable material over soil to help control weeds, retain moisture, and improve garden appearance, typically handled by local contractors familiar with the area.

Why should I consider mulch fabric for my landscape? Using mulch fabric can reduce weed growth, improve soil moisture retention, and create a cleaner, more polished look for garden beds, with local service providers able to assist with proper installation.

How do local contractors install mulch fabric? Contractors typically prepare the area, lay down the fabric smoothly over the soil, and secure it with landscape staples or pins to ensure it stays in place during use.

Can mulch fabric be used around trees and shrubs? Yes, mulch fabric is suitable around trees and shrubs to suppress weeds and maintain moisture, with local pros able to customize the installation for different plant types.

What types of mulch fabric are available for installation? There are various types, including woven and non-woven fabrics, each suited for different landscaping needs, and local service providers can recommend the best option for specific projects.
